I loved this authors previous books in this series and this short novella was a capitivating and fabulous read.
Ryan and Tessa were childhood friends and over the years their lives took different paths but they communicated with each other every day. Tessa is in town at last and the two reunite and both find the attraction that was always there reignited.
I loved Ryan, he kind and caring, loves his family and spends time with them when not fighting fires. Tessa fits right back into his life with ease and their spark and connection only grows stronger.
Although it’s a fake dating romance it was clear from the start that there was nothing fake about Ryan and Tessa.
Wonderful novella, spicy and sweet and cannot wait to read the next two books in the series. A wonderful well written romance.

Tessa (from Falling for Whiskey Duet) is heading to Tahoe to be her best friend Ryan's fake girlfriend for his sister's wedding. These two have been best friends since childhood, but each have been harbouring secret feelings for the other.
Tessa was the my favourite character from the Falling for Whiskey duet and I continued to loved her in this spicy novella. She is wild and sassy, unequivocally herself.
I loved Ryan and Tessa's dynamic. You could cut the tension with a knife, their chemistry was absolutely fire.
I loved lumbersnack Ryan! He is swoonworthy! I love the relationship he has with his niece, it is absolutely adorable.
My only 2 complaints were... We didn't need Shawn's POV and I wish this had have been a full length novel instead of a novella. I want more of them!
Tropes: fake dating, one bed, best friends to lovers
